Output dd8d5bf991fdad4aad5b2782a96e239c9ab004f8f0bfdd993e934253a9a889d3:15

value
740131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8686db6e2ae8aeadcf387aaffaa39a829d46712a OP_EQUAL
address
3DxL2HfJSG8uDeWqJZhuxiREuybwPZ74Ew
transaction
dd8d5bf991fdad4aad5b2782a96e239c9ab004f8f0bfdd993e934253a9a889d3
spent
true